Research Grants Team work closely with the University of Edinburgh research and professional service communities, partners and funders, to maximise the research academic colleagues can undertake for the funding they receive.

We are looking for a **Research Grants Support Administrator **to join our expert team in supporting the delivery of financial management and post award administration across the EU and International teams.

You will work collaboratively across the Research Grants team and with colleagues across a range of departments to provide crucial administrative support. This includes the setup of new awards, assisting with funder audits, using the People and Money system for processing transactions and managing the team mailboxes for queries and support

**Your skills and attributes for success**:

- A finance background is highly desirable, with an understanding of financial reconciliation and audit requirements, foreign currency implications.
- Ability to prioritise and manage your own workload, work under pressure to tight deadlines, and cope with conflicting demands.
- Ability to establish effective working relationships and communicate effectively, both orally and in writing
- High level of numeracy with good attention to detail Good IT skills including word processing, and spreadsheets.

**The Research Grants Team **is responsible for the recovery of c£324m research income across 3,500 research awards. You will be a key support to the wider team of 40 and we work closely with colleagues across all academic departments in the University assisting in the management of research awards.
